Parks and Wildlife Service at the Department of Biodiversity, Conservation and Attractions delivers on-ground operations across the following Divisions: Parks and Visitor Services Division works with the community and volunteers to facilitate public involvement, visitation and appreciation of the natural and cultural environment on lands and waters managed by the department. Conservation and Ecosystem Management Division is responsible for forest management and statewide management of pests, weeds and plant diseases. They are also responsible for providing advice on the management of the Swan Canning Riverpark, delivering environmental planning, management and monitoring programs and assessing and providing advice on development proposals affecting the park. The Regional and Fire Management Services Division implements the department’s responsibilities in national parks, nature reserves, marine parks, State forests and other lands and waters throughout the State. The division works with neighbours, volunteers (including volunteer bushfire brigades), partners, individuals, organisations and communities. The Nature-Based Tourism Division promotes and supports nature and culture-based tourism opportunities on CALM Act land. The division is the point of contact for departmental staff and the tourism industry to facilitate sustainable, nature and culture-based commercial tourism and attractions on national, marine and conservation parks and reserves managed by the Parks and Wildlife Service.

For over 50 years, Trust for Nature has been protecting ecosystems and wildlife on private land in Victoria, in collaboration with private landholders. In Victoria, 62% of the land is privately owned, so working with private landholders is critical to secure the future of our unique ecosystems and species. Across our 40+ nature reserves, and 1500+ properties owned by individuals, our passionate team helps restore, preserve and improve habitats, engaging with local communities and Traditional Owners to share knowledge, restore cultural practices and generate greater outcomes for Victoria’s unique plant and animal species. To date we have protected more than hectares of private land. We support private land conservation through conservation covenants; an ongoing stewardship support program; a Revolving Fund and the purchase of land for permanent protection; restoration and biodiversity offsets. Together, we are creating a future in which Victoria's nature is valued, protected and thriving.

Ecotourism Australia (EA) is a non-government, not-for-profit organisation, established in 1991, that promotes and supports the ecotourism industry in Australia through building capacity and actively promoting sustainable tourism operations and systems. Our key program – ECO Certification – was the world’s first national ecotourism certification program. Ecotourism Australia is acknowledged globally for our industry standards and our certification programs are recognised by the Global Sustainable Tourism Council (GSTC). We are recognised as a credible, national peak body for sustainable and nature-based tourism. We have 500 certified operators and 1700 certified experiences in our ECO, Climate Action, and Respecting Our Culture Certifications. In 2018 Ecotourism Australia launched the ECO Destination Certification program where operators and government work together to demonstrate a community-wide and entire regions’ commitment to sustainable tourism management practices. Ecotourism Australia and our certified operators and destinations are committed to sustainable destination management, protecting the natural environment and bridging the gap between tourism and conservation.
